DataGridViewButtonCell.OnKeyDown(KeyEventArgs, Int32) Método
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
É chamada quando uma tecla de carácter é pressionada enquanto o foco está na célula.
protected:
override void OnKeyDown(System::Windows::Forms::KeyEventArgs ^ e, int rowIndex);
protected override void OnKeyDown(System.Windows.Forms.KeyEventArgs e, int rowIndex);
override this.OnKeyDown : System.Windows.Forms.KeyEventArgs * int -> unit
Protected Overrides Sub OnKeyDown (e As KeyEventArgs, rowIndex As Integer)
Parâmetros
A KeyEventArgs que contém os dados do evento.
- rowIndex
- Int32
O índice de linha da célula atual, ou -1 se a célula não pertence a uma linha.
Observações
Quando ativado pela tecla SPACE, este método atualiza a interface de utilizador (UI) da célula.
Este método é semelhante ao Control.OnKeyDown método. É chamado nas mesmas circunstâncias em que um Control.KeyDown evento é elevado, mas não eleva realmente o evento.
Notas para Herdeiros
Ao substituir OnKeyDown(KeyEventArgs, Int32) uma classe derivada, certifique-se de chamar o método da OnKeyDown(KeyEventArgs, Int32) classe base para que os delegados registados recebam o evento.
Aplica-se a
Ver também
- KeyDownUnsharesRow(KeyEventArgs, Int32)
- KeyEventArgs
- DataGridView
- OnKeyDown(KeyEventArgs)
- KeyDown
- OnKeyUp(KeyEventArgs, Int32)
- Space
- manipulação padrão de teclado e mouse no de controle DataGridView do Windows Forms